December 27, 1934 – March 6, 2022
Oskaloosa, Iowa | Age 87

Bonnie Lou Smith, 87, of Oskaloosa and formerly of Idaho, passed away Sunday, March 6, 2022, at Northern Mahaska Specialty Care in Oskaloosa. She was born on December 27, 1934, in Mahaska County, Iowa, the daughter of Wilbur Ora and Ruth Joy (Moore) Barnard.

Bonnie graduated from the Cedar High School with the Class of 1952.

On June 8, 1952, Bonnie was united in marriage to John Warren Smith in Cedar, Iowa. To this union two children were born, Colleen and Kyle. Bonnie and Warren shared 55 years of marriage together until Warren passed away in April 2008.

Bonnie and Warren moved to California and lived there for several years before moving back to Oskaloosa in 1991. Bonnie worked for KFC for several years and had a large part in establishing the KFC in Oskaloosa. She started as general manager and worked her way up to supervisor for Iowa and surrounding states.

Bonnie was an excellent cook and enjoyed serving meals to her family. Her real joy in life was spending time with her grandchildren.

“We had to say goodbye to our mother and grandmother this week. We will forever remember and cherish how much fun we used to have spending weekends at her house, how much she loved to cook for the family, and how she made us feel special. We love her and will miss her dearly.”

Bonnie is survived by her children, Colleen (& John) Merrill of Oskaloosa and Kyle (& Patti) Smith of Cottage Grove, Wisconsin; four grandchildren: Emiliana, Jennifer, Jenell, and Mikaela; her great-grandchildren: Valena and Avalen; a sister, Pat DeWitt of Oskaloosa; and many a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ews and cousins.

Bonnie is preceded in death by her husband Warren; her parents, Wilbur and Ruth Barnard; a sister, Ruth Lane; and five brothers: Jack Barnard, Glen “Joe” Barnard, Bill Barnard, Jay Barnard and Rex Barnard.

As was Bonnie’s wish, her body will be cremated, and no services are planned at this time. The Bates Funeral Chapel is in charge of arrangements.
Memorials may be made to Stephen Memorial Animal Shelter.
